Patricia “Patty” Dolores Bloch

1938 — May 15, 2020

Patricia “Patty” Dolores Bloch entered the kingdom of our Lord, Friday, May 15 at 8 p.m. Patty resided at Hickory Creek Healthcare in Winamac at the time of her passing and spent the last 20 years as a proud member of the Francesville community. 

Born in 1938, to the late Alton C. and Anna Marie Wien, of Detroit, Patty was a true “Michigander” and loved all things Great Lakes — especially waves crashing and seagulls. In 1995, she retired from the Parkside Credit Union in Michigan and began making plans for her life after retirement. Patty has numerous family members, especially her grandchildren, who would like to express their sincerest thank yous to the phenomenal staff at Hickory Creek and for the care and compassion that was made available to Patty and the family during her last years.

 “Our Memaw may have forgotten us in the end, but we will never forget her, or her beautiful soul.” 

She is survived by 10 grandchildren and their families: Rachael Bloch and Monica Spurlin (daughters of Cheryl (Bloch) Spurlin); Kelly Bloch (daughter of Jeffrey Bloch); Raymond Bloch III, Samantha Bagley, Justin Braden, Amanda [Aeron] Jimenez, April Bloch and Amy Bloch (sons and daughters of Raymond Bloch II); and numerous great-grandchildren, nieces, nephews and other loving family members.

She was preceded in death by her parents Alton C. and Anna Marie Wien; sons: Jeffrey Bloch and Raymond D. Bloch II; daughter Cheryl (Bloch) Spurlin; brother Joseph William “Bill” Wien; and granddaughter Trisha Spurlin. 

A memorial service will be at 2 p.m. on Saturday, June 6, at Frain Mortuary in Winamac. Entombment will be at Roseland Cemetery in Francesville.
